Fog Modification

Fog Modification PDF Author: Bernard A. Silverman
Publisher:
ISBN:
Category : Evaporation
Languages : en
Pages : 56

Book Description
The report is a comprehensive review of fog modification. It includes discussions of the physical structure and climatological characteristics of various types of fog. The three different methods of fog modification, that is, removal, evaporation and prevention are discussed, as are the general requirements of fog dispersal. In depth descriptions are given of the techniques used to modify supercooled, warm, and ice fog. (Author).

A Modern Thermo-kinetic Warm Fog Dispersal System

A Modern Thermo-kinetic Warm Fog Dispersal System PDF Author: Bruce A. Kunkel
Publisher:
ISBN:
Category : Aeronautics
Languages : en
Pages : 36

Book Description
An extensive investigation has been made to arrive at optimum specifications for a thermo-kinetic warm fog dispersal system. This study included passive heat tests, sub-scale heat/momentum tests, and tests with a single full-scale runway combustor and an approach zone combustor. These tests were augmented with extensive analytical modeling of buoyant jets under coflowing and counterflowing wind conditions. The landing category and the operational requirements within each category are the primary factors affecting the size of the thermal fog dispersal system (TFDS). A Cat 2 TFDS employs 22 percent fewer combustors and uses 50 percent less fuel than a Cat 1 TFDS. The combustor specification and orientation are presented for both Cat 1 and Cat 2 systems.
